Fast visual ID list
- Philodendron hederaceum — heart leaves; climbing/trailing; oxalates.
- Epipremnum aureum — variegated trailing vine; oxalates.
- Dieffenbachia seguine — speckled broad leaves; thick cane; oxalates.
- Spathiphyllum wallisii — spathe + spadix; broad leaves; oxalates.
- Cycas revoluta — stiff pinnate fronds; seeds highly toxic.
- Lilium spp. — showy trumpet/bowl flowers; dangerous to cats.
- Hemerocallis spp. — daylilies; cat hazard.
- Zamioculcas zamiifolia — glossy pinnate leaflets; rhizomes.
- Aloe vera — toothed succulent leaves; gel inside.
- Crassula ovata — woody succulent with oval leaves.
Safer styling ideas
Use shelves, hanging planters, and closed terrariums; rotate in pet-safe options like Chlorophytum comosum (Spider Plant) or Parlor Palm (Chamaedorea elegans).
